Output 81dc596884d629ecce63e3d51d8bd5fb9c1f591537f33595747b0889e4d2fdc1:1

value
336932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03aa7a769e620f12b3168cd077edfab796f57de5 OP_EQUAL
address
322QBAUhR85KQWphS12wrJVaGKNM5uzKVS
transaction
81dc596884d629ecce63e3d51d8bd5fb9c1f591537f33595747b0889e4d2fdc1
confirmations
370365
spent
true